The Farmhouse Ambewela By Celeste

The Farmhouse Ambewela By Celeste is a Home Stay located in Ambewela. It is one of the 302 Home stays in Sri Lanka. Address of The Farmhouse Ambewela By Celeste is The Jaysons Farm, Pilot project, Ambewela, Sri Lanka. The Farmhouse Ambewela By Celeste can be contacted at 94775882626. The Farmhouse Ambewela By Celeste is rated 5 (out of 5 stars) by 2 reviewers on the web.

Some of the places around The Farmhouse Ambewela By Celeste are -

Ambewela Railway Station (Train station) World's End Road, Ambewela, Sri Lanka (approx. 312 meters)
Sushi Guest Rendapola road,, Ambewela 22216, Sri Lanka (approx. 310 meters)
Ambewela Sub Post Office (Post office) Ambewela, Sri Lanka (approx. 326 meters)
Ambewela (approx. 100 meters)
Ambewela Sinhala Vidyalaya (School) Blackpool-Ambewela-Pattipola-Horton Plain Rd, Nuwara Eliya, Sri Lanka (approx. 235 meters)
Ambewela Beer Bar Ambewela, Sri Lanka (approx. 278 meters)
The Farmhouse Ambewela By Celeste (Home Stay) The Jaysons Farm, Pilot project, Ambewela, Sri Lanka (approx. 100 meters)
ambewela hospital (Hospital) Ambewela, Sri Lanka (approx. 236 meters)
Ambewela Junction (Landmark) Ambewela, Rendapola-Ambewela Rd, Sri Lanka (approx. 166 meters)
Ambewela Sinhala Viduhala (School) Ambewela, Sri Lanka (approx. 230 meters)

Within less than half a Kilo meter of The Farmhouse Ambewela By Celeste, you can also find Ambewela Railway Goodshed, Ambewela rooms, Mashallha Hotel, Susi Gest, ambewela stores, Ambewela High Products, Ambewela School Ground, Ambewella Buddhist Temple, and many more.

Rating

5/5

Contact

Address

The Jaysons Farm, Pilot project, Ambewela, Sri Lanka

Location

FAQs:

What is the contact Number of The Farmhouse Ambewela By Celeste?
Contact number of The Farmhouse Ambewela By Celeste is 94775882626.
What is rating of The Farmhouse Ambewela By Celeste?
Rating of The Farmhouse Ambewela By Celeste is 5 out of 5 stars.
What is the address of The Farmhouse Ambewela By Celeste?
Address of The Farmhouse Ambewela By Celeste is The Jaysons Farm, Pilot project, Ambewela, Sri Lanka.
Where is the The Farmhouse Ambewela By Celeste located?
The Farmhouse Ambewela By Celeste is located in Ambewela.

People also search for